How much do communication entry level j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for communication entry level in Phoenix, AZ is $48,716.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$41,200.00 and $55,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a communication entry level job?

Communication entry level jobs are positions designed for recent graduates or those new to the communications field. These roles often involve tasks such as writing press releases, creating social media content, assisting with public relations campaigns, and supporting marketing or internal communications efforts. Entry level positions provide valuable experience and help build foundational skills in writing, media relations, and digital communication. They are typically found in industries like public relations, marketing, corporate communications, and nonprofit organizations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a communication entry level professional?

To thrive as a Communication Entry Level professional, you need strong written and verbal communication abilities, a relevant bachelor's degree (such as communications, public relations, or journalism), and a foundational understanding of media principles. Familiarity with digital communication tools, social media platforms, and basic content management systems is often required. Adaptability, attention to detail, and collaboration skills help you stand out in supporting communication projects and engaging diverse audiences. These capabilities are essential for effectively conveying messages, maintaining brand reputation, and supporting organizational goals.

What are some common challenges faced by entry-level communication professionals, and how can they be addressed?

Entry-level communication professionals often encounter challenges such as adapting to fast-paced environments, managing multiple projects simultaneously, and effectively tailoring messages for diverse audiences. Building strong organizational skills and seeking feedback from experienced team members can help overcome these hurdles. Additionally, staying up to date with digital communication tools and being proactive in learning from colleagues will support your growth and success in the role.

Communication Entry Level roles focus on conveying information effectively within organizations or to the public, often involving writing, editing, or media tasks. Customer Service Representatives primarily handle customer inquiries, complaints, and support. While both roles require strong communication skills, the former emphasizes strategic messaging, whereas the latter centers on customer interaction and problem-solving.

How to start a career in communication entry level?

To start a career in entry-level communication roles, gain relevant skills such as strong written and verbal communication, and consider earning a degree in communications, journalism, or related fields. Internships, volunteering, or entry-level positions can provide practical experience and help build a professional network.

What jobs can I do with communication entry level experience?

With entry-level communication experience, you can pursue roles such as customer service representative, administrative assistant, social media coordinator, or receptionist. These jobs typically require strong verbal and written skills, basic computer proficiency, and the ability to work in team environments.
